Step-by-Step Guide to Set Up Your Trezor Wallet
Step 1: Visit the Official Site
Open your browser and go to https://trezor.io/start. Double-check the URL and ensure your connection is secure (look for the padlock icon).
Step 2: Select Your Trezor Model
The page lets you pick between Trezor Model One and Trezor Model T. Both models offer robust security, but Model T includes a touchscreen and supports more cryptocurrencies.
Step 3: Download and Install Trezor Suite
From the start page, download the official Trezor Suite application. Available for Windows, macOS, and Linux, Trezor Suite is the desktop app where you’ll manage your wallet. There is also a browser-based option if you prefer.
Step 4: Connect Your Trezor Device
Plug your Trezor into your computer using the USB cable. The Trezor Suite will detect your device and prompt you to install the latest firmware — a critical step to keep your wallet secure and updated.
Step 5: Initialize Your Wallet
Choose “Create new wallet.” Your Trezor device will generate a recovery seed phrase — a series of 12 or 24 words. This seed is the master key to your wallet and assets. Write it down carefully on the provided recovery card or a secure piece of paper. Never save it digitally or share it.
Step 6: Set Your PIN
You’ll be asked to create a PIN code for unlocking the device. A PIN adds an extra layer of security, ensuring that only you can access your wallet even if someone physically steals the device.
Step 7: Start Managing Your Crypto
With your wallet initialized, you can now send, receive, and store cryptocurrencies securely through Trezor Suite. The app offers a clean, user-friendly interface to track your portfolio and perform transactions safely.
Key Features of Trezor Wallet via Trezor.io/Start
- Cold storage security: Your private keys never leave the device, preventing online hacks.
- Open-source firmware: Trezor’s code is transparent and regularly audited by the community.
- Multi-asset support: Manage over 1,000 c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in, Ethereum, and altcoins.
- Passphrase protection: Add an extra secret phrase for an additional security layer.
- Seamless updates: Firmware updates improve security and functionality, easily installed via Trezor Suite.
Tips for Keeping Your Trezor Wallet Safe
- Only use Trezor.io/Start for downloads and setup.
- Store your recovery seed offline in a safe place. Consider using a fireproof safe or a dedicated seed storage device.
- Never share your PIN or recovery phrase with anyone.
- Confirm transaction details directly on your Trezor device screen before approving.
- Be cautious of phishing emails or fake websites pretending to be Trezor support.
